Android photography sees a boost with key apps enhancing camera features and editing capabilities. ProShot, Open Camera, Adobe Lightroom Mobile, and Snapseed are leading the charge.
ProShot: Manual DSLR Controls
ProShot adds DSLR-style manual controls to Android devices, enabling adjustments to ISO, shutter speed, and exposure. The app supports both RAW and JPEG formats. It is available for a one-time purchase of $8, with a free evaluator app to check compatibility.
Open Camera: Free Versatility
Open Camera offers a robust alternative to default camera apps. It supports RAW and JPEG, HDR auto-alignment, and dynamic range optimization, all at no cost. Ads are present, but there are no in-app purchases or subscriptions.
Adobe Lightroom Mobile: AI Editing
Lightroom Mobile provides a professional-grade camera and editing suite. The app offers expansive editing tools, with AI features available through subscription plans starting at $12 per month.
Snapseed: Advanced Photo Editing
Snapseed, a free app devoid of ads and watermarks, enables professional-level photo edits with layer-based workflows and film-like filters. It complements capture apps like ProShot and Open Camera.
Together, these applications enhance Android photography, meeting diverse needs from capturing to editing with precision.
